Copper-alloy Quinarius of Allectus (AD293 - 296)
Obv. IMP C ALL[ECTVS] P F AVG: Bust of Allectus, radiate, draped, cuirassed, right
Rev. VIRTVS AVG: Galley, left, with mast and six rowers
Mint: London
Dated: AD293 - 296
Reece Period: 14
